Terrelle Pryor to Start in Oakland Raiders’ Final Preseason Game

Terrelle Pryor will get a shot at the Oakland Raiders’ starting quarterback job.

Coach Dennis Allen said Sunday that Pryor will start their final preseason game Thursday against the Seattle Seahawks. Allen added that QB Matt Flynn, who has been struggling, won’t play in the game, which leave an opening for Pryor to shine in his first start.

“It’s probably more of a precautionary measure on my part than it is anything else,” Allen said. “We’ll get a chance to see Terrelle this week with the first-unit offense up against Seattle, and we’ll see how he does.”

The two quarterbacks have been in a tight quarterback competition since the beginning of the Raiders’ training camp.

Flynn took a slight lead and has been the starter throughout camp, but since he has shown signs of inconsistencies, Pryor has been pushed to start the struggling Raiders offense.

“Coach told me what the deal was, that Matt wasn’t playing on Friday and he wanted me to jump with the first team and lead them into Seattle,” Pryor said. “I’m definitely not all the way there in terms of the playbook and in terms of just being a quarterback out there. Don’t get me wrong, I can lead if I was called upon to do it. I’m just out there getting better and trying to get in sync with the guys.”
